Incapacitated (Condition Type)

From Baldur's Gate 3 Wiki
Jump to navigation Jump to search

Any condition that can alter or prevent the actions a character normally has available to them. Examples include: Frightened, Paralysed, Stunned, Restrained, Polymorphed, Charmed, and Dominated.

Downed (Condition) Downed

  • If you reach 0 hit points, you fall Unconscious and must make Death Saving Throws. On 3 successes, you stop bleeding out and become Stable. On 3 failures, you Dead die.
  • Any damage you receive while unconscious counts as one failure.
  • If you regain any Hit Points, the condition is removed. If an ally helps you, you regain 1 hit point.

Feigning Death (Condition) Feigning Death

  • Has sunk into a magical coma deep enough to imitate death
  • Resistant to all damage except Damage Types Psychic damage, and Disease and Poison no longer have any effect
  • Removed when Helped

Gossamer Tomb (Condition) Gossamer Tomb

  • This creature is entombed in Infested Infested spider silk, and cannot move or take actions. Unless the silk is removed with Damage Types Acid or Damage Types Fire damage, it will explode, dealing 8d10Damage TypesPoison to the entombed creature.

Grotesque Distension (Condition) Grotesque Distension

  • Bloated beyond hope. Will explode at the slightest touch.
  • Touching an entity affected with this condition will cause a blast of 8d6Damage TypesPoison damage in an AoE: 3 m / 3 ft (Radius), form a Poison Cloud of the same size, and utterly destroy the entity.

Infernal Stun (Condition) Infernal Stun

This creature cannot move or act, and Raphael can Soul Drain Soul Drain it at will.

Dexterity saving throw with difficulty class 16 on balanced, and 18 on tactician. The stun immunity from Helm of Balduran does not protect against infernal stun.

Turned to Gold (Condition) Turned to Gold

  • Turned to gold. Can't move or take actions, bonus actions, or reactions.
  • At the end of each turn, the affected entity makes a DC 17  Constitution saving throw to end this condition.
